
Susan Golyak
Director, ESG
Location: VictoriaSusan joined BCI in 2016 and is responsible for overseeing ESG analysis and integration for portfolio companies and leads ESG engagement with corporate issuers, regulators, and external managers. In her role, Susan also develops public policy submissions and provides education to clients on ESG-related matters which are essential to BCI’s investment beliefs. With $250.4 billion of gross managed assets as of March 31, 2024, BCI is one of Canada’s largest institutional investors within the global capital markets.
Prior to joining BCI, Susan held the role of responsible investment analyst at OPTrust, a prominent Canadian institutional investor, where she was involved in portfolio integration of responsible investment principles.
Susan holds an MBA from the University of Fredericton’s Sandermoen School of Business focused on social enterprise leadership and currently serves as a board member of the Pension Investment Association of Canada, and previously chaired their Investor Stewardship Committee.
